View the Cotopaxi Fuego Product LineView all Cotopaxi Women's Down Jackets| Best Use | Multisport |
|---|---|
| Fabric | Shell: 100% recycled nylon, 37 g/m2, C0 durable water repellent (DWR) 80/10 finish with downproof coating, made without intentionally added PFAS chemicals |
| Lining Fabric | 100% recycled nylon, 37 g/m2, made without intentionally added PFAS chemicals |
| Insulated | Yes |
| Insulation Type | Down |
| Insulation | 800-fill-power down |
| Warmth | Warmer |
| Water-Resistant Down | Yes |
| Hood | Yes |
| Packable | Yes |
| Back Length | Hip-length |
| Back Length (in.) | 25.5 inches |
| Gender | Women's |
| Weight | Unavailable |
| Sustainability | Fair Trade Certified Contains recycled materials |

Excited for this new jacket! My new fuego max is so light I didn't think it would be warm. . . But it is amazing and toasty especially while hiking and moving. I have a fuego that I have worn to death, lol, from about 3 years ago and it weighs the same and is sooooo warm especially when moving. Its a bit boxy but thats great for layering. I will see how durable it is with time, since the outside is so soft it seems like it would not be as tough. I'd say it is roomier than my old fuego, they are both XS, I am 5'1" and around 120 lbs.
This is the perfect packable puffer for my upcoming hiking trip. I LOVE that this coat stuffs into its own pocket fits easily in my travel backpack. Although I own several of Cotopaxi’s brightly colored jackets and packs, I am excited this coat was offered in a “go with everything” neutral. Warm, packable, and with ample pockets!
I think the jacket is lovely. My only suggestion would be to have more information and even possibly another style selection for those who want a more fitted look—my new jacket is pretty large around the midsection for my body shape.
I was initially worried with how light the jacket was that it wouldn’t be warm, but it is so incredibly warm for the harsh northeast winters!
The feather down leaks out of this jacket like water through a sieve. Hoping it doesn’t lose all of its warmth in its first season, and that Cotopaxi honors their warranty.
We went with this jacket over the arctyrcs and love them so much. My husband and I got matching ones and they are amazing. So comfortable, cute, and keep you SO warm.
This jacket is cozy and will definitely keep you warm. My only complaint is that it does seem to be a little narrow on the shoulders.
